/* CSS Document */
body {padding:0; margin:0; color:#879397}
br{font-size:10px}
.text{font-family:Verdana, Tahoma; font-size:10px;  color:#3E4D55; text-decoration:none}

 
/*Bildersatzueberschrift*/
.headline{
font-family:Verdana, Tahoma;font-size:12px;color:#3E4D55;text-decoration:none; font-weight:bold;
}

/* Styles Language*/
 .topstyle_left{
 margin-bottom:7px;margin-left:15px;
 }
.whiteSel{
 font-family:Verdana, Tahoma; font-weight:bold; font-size:10px;color:#FFFFFF;text-decoration:none;
 }
.topUnSel{
 font-family:Verdana, Tahoma;font-size:10px;color:#354143;text-decoration:none;
 }

/*Newslinktitel ausgewaehlt: ja/nein */
 .titleUnsel{
 font-family:Verdana, Tahoma;font-size:10px;color:#FFFFFF;text-decoration:none; font-weight:bold;
 }
 .titleSel{
 font-family:Verdana, Tahoma;font-size:10px;color:#354143;text-decoration:none; font-weight:bold;
 }

 /*Styles Unternavigation*/
 .bottomstyle{
 margin-top:25px;margin-bottom:0px;
 }
.bottomUnSel{
 font-family:Verdana, Tahoma;font-size:10px;color:#CBDADF;text-decoration:none;
 } 
 .bottom a:link, .bottom a:visited, .bottom a:active, .bottom a:focus {
 font-family:Verdana, Tahoma; font-size:10px;  color:#CBDADF;text-decoration:none;
 }
  .bottom a:hover{
 font-family:Verdana, Tahoma; font-size:10px;color:#FFFFFF;text-decoration:none;
 }

/* Styles Hilfsnavigation*/
.top a:link, .top a:visited, .top a:active, .top a:focus {
 font-family:Verdana, Tahoma; font-size:10px;  color:#354143;text-decoration:none;
 }
  .top a:hover{
 font-family:Verdana, Tahoma; font-size:10px;color:#FFFFFF;text-decoration:none;
 }
 .topstyle{
 margin-bottom:7px;margin-right:15px; 
 }
 
 /*Newslinks*/
.dgrau{
}
.dgrau a:link, .dgrau a:visited, .dgrau a:active, .dgrau a:focus {
 width:100%; height: 100%;
 font-family:Verdana, Tahoma; font-size:10px; color:#ffffff;text-decoration:none;
 padding-left: 0px; padding-bottom:0px; margin-left: 0px;
 line-height:14px;
 }
.dgrau a:hover{
 width:100%; height: 100%;
 font-family:Verdana, Tahoma; font-size:10px; color:#354143;text-decoration:none;
 padding-left: 0px; padding-bottom:0px; margin-left: 0px;line-height:14px;
 }
 
/*Links im Text*/ 

 .l a:link, .l a:visited, .l a:active, .l a:focus {
 font-family:Verdana, Tahoma; font-size:10px;color:#FF9900;text-decoration:none;
 line-height:14px;
 }
 .l a:hover{
font-family:Verdana, Tahoma; font-size:10px;color:#FF9900;text-decoration:none;
 line-height:14px;
 }
/*Angabe wegen TinyMCE*/
.textlink{
}
/*Ende Angabe wegen TinyMCE*/

/*für <a href="#" class="textlink">
/*a.textlink:link, a.textlink:visited, a.textlink:active, a.textlink:focus{
font-family:Verdana, Tahoma; 
font-size:10px;
color:#FF9900;
text-decoration:none;
background:url("../upload/bullets/list_icon_arrow_or.gif") no-repeat;
padding-left:13px;
}

a.textlink:hover{
font-family:Verdana, Tahoma; 
font-size:10px;
color:#FF9900;
text-decoration:none;
background:url("../upload/bullets/list_icon_arrow_or.gif") no-repeat;
padding-left:13px;
}*/

.textlink a:link, .textlink a:visited, .textlink a:active, .textlink a:focus{
font-family:Verdana, Tahoma; 
font-size:10px;
color:#FF9900;
text-decoration:none;
background:url("../upload/bullets/list_icon_arrow_or.gif") no-repeat;
padding-left:13px;
}

.textlink a:hover{
font-family:Verdana, Tahoma; 
font-size:10px;
color:#FF9900;
text-decoration:none;
background:url("../upload/bullets/list_icon_arrow_or.gif") no-repeat;
padding-left:13px;
}

a.galerie-navigation:active, a.galerie-navigation:link, a.galerie-navigation:visited, a.galerie-navigation:hover, a.galerie-navigation:focus{
font-family:Verdana, Tahoma; 
font-size:10px;
color:#FF9900;
text-decoration:none;
}

/*Positionierung Headerbilder*/
#headerbox1 {
	position:relative;
	top:0px;
	left:0px;
	width:680px;
	height: 190px;
	z-index:1;
	white-space:nowrap;}

#headerbox2 { 
	position:absolute; 
	top:132px; 
	left:160px; 
	z-index:2; }

/*/////////////////////////////////////////////////////////////////////////////*/
  #input{
  		width:160px; height:21px;
		
		}
		 
#input1{
  		width:134px; height:21px;
		
		}
		
	  #textarea{
  		width:102px; height:48px;
		border-width:1px;
		border-style:solid;
		border:none;
		background-color:#F0EAE3;
		overflow:auto
		}

.NewsletterInput{
	width:110px;
	height:15px;
	padding-top:5px;
	border-width:1px;
	border-style:solid;
	border:none;
	background-color:#F0EAE3;
	font-family:Tahoma; 
	font-size:10px;
	}
 